>>14490917
Mythography's a genre, so there are very many books to choose from. For the Greeks Graves is pretty thorough (although I don't subscribe to his historically oriented theory) but I like Calasso's Marriage of Cadmus and Harmony best.
Classically, Ovid's Metamorphoses is the one I'll probably reread. --And Fasti too if Roman Holidays are of interest.. like the Fornicalia (Feb 17)
Fornax in Latin is oven btw
